Spring LakeSpringLake is a town that brings many visitors to the JerseyShoreevery summer. It remains one of the most favored destinations along the Shore. There are so many things to occupy your time in Spring Lake, including a day at the beach, bike riding or walking around Spring Lake, the lake which the town was named for, or shopping down Third Ave.
All year round, SpringLake’s various Bed and Breakfast Inns provide value for tourists. When Memorial Day comes around, SpringLake hosts a 5 mile run, which has grown to be one of the largest on New Jersey.
The real estate market in SpringLake is more resilient than most New Jersey markets with prices holding and sales moving at a good pace.
In 2007 SpringLake saw a very good year with 68 single family homes sold. 50% more units than 2006. The average sale price for homes in Spring Lake was $2,051,000. So far in 2008 we are seeing unit sales down with 59 homes sold or under contract through September. As of September there were 66 homes on the market in Spring Lake ranging from $649,900 to $8,195,000 compared to last year's 69 homes on the market in September.
